Bad Breath
This can be as a result of ingesting certain foods that release sulphur compound into the mouth and bloodstream, but it can often be a problem insufficient oral hygiene in which bacteria feed on the remaining food particles after a meal and the sulphur odour is given off as a digestive by-product. Constipation
Constipation is a gastrointestinal disorder characterised by slow and/or irregular contractions of the large intestines so that the waste is not able to move through the tract and be expelled as it should, one to three times per day; the result of a high fat/low fibre and fluid diet.
